摘要
目前,用电信息采集异常精确定位一直没有得到较好的解决,本文提出的基于GPRS的信息采集定位系统技术方案,很好地克服了传统集抄系统无法进行故障信息上报,无法进行故障定位,系统复杂的缺陷。该系统在每个数据采集处装手机卡,通过手机号码识别智能电表的确切位置,实现异常精确定位,中心服务器获取数据有两种模式,即主动读取智能电表数据和被动获取集中器传送的异常数据,满足用户对数据的要求,系统通过WEB服务器向用户提供报表服务,具有良好的人机交互作用。
Accurate anomaly positioning of electric energy data acquisition is unsolved at present. The technical solution of information collection and positioning system based on GPRS is proposed to well overcome the defect of traditional meter reading system, like unable abnormal information reporting, unable anomaly positioning and complicated system. Installing mobile phone card in each place of data acquisition, this system can identify the accurate position of smart meter by phone number and achieve accurate anomaly positioning. Center server has two modes to acquire data: read the data of smart meter actively and acquire the abnormal data sent by concentrator passively, which meets the requirements of users for data. The system provides reporting services for users by Web server and plays an important role in human-computer interaction.
